ALTGX Setting
These settings are to dynamically reconfigure the transceiver
channel to listen to the alternate transmitter PLL.
The available options are Auto, Low, Medium, and High.
Select the appropriate option based on your system
requirements.
Each transceiver block has two CMU PLLs. Each CMU/ATX
PLL has a dedicated power down signal called
pll_powerdown. This signal powers down the CMU PLL.
Each CMU/ATX PLL has a dedicated pll_locked signal that
is fed to the FPGA fabric to indicate when the PLL is locked to
the input reference clock.
This option is only available for certain data rates. Refer to the
DC and Switching Characteristics for Stratix IV Devices
chapter for the supported data rates.
This option enables the auxiliary transmitter PLL. This is a
low-jitter PLL that resides between the transceiver blocks and
can be used as a transmitter PLL.
If you select the input clock frequency option in the What
would you like to base the setting on? field, the ALTGX
MegaWizard Plug-In Manager displays the list of effective
serial data rates in this field.
If you select the data rate option in the What would you
like to base the setting on? field, the ALTGX MegaWizard
Plug-In Manager allows you to specify the effective serial
data rate value in this field.
